CAMPAIGN AGAINST CHILD ABUSE


The environment against persons provisions act enacted last year 2015 by the Nigerian National Assembly is aimed at preventing all forms of abuse of persons and private and public life. It provide maximum protection and effectively for victims and punishment of offenders, with the excite on the cases of Abuse and Rape of Children, the National Secretary of International Federation of Women Lawyer FIBA MRS. RHODA THEODORA  said the objective of the campaign is to educate children on how to identify these abuses and report them to appropriate authorities.

 The National Publicity Secretary of FIBA CHRISTIAN FRANCHISCA CHUKWUANI  who spoke on the child like act outlined some of the allegation of children under the law: according  to her she said a child have to know that their mother and father provide for them and as a result, they have to be responsible and obedient. Also the principal of Junior Secondary school Life Camp Abuja, Nigeria MRS. VICTORIA ELONU said the teachers has been instructed to correct students with Law, Order and other corporal punishment.

Some of the students are Emmanueller Oyene and Master Jotory Chibuzo said he had been well informed that their right and according to the little kids they said that they have well understood their right as a good citizens of Nigeria that whenever they are being abused or molested by any person or adult, that they will not relent in reporting to any available responsible elderly persons or their parents.  So that when the person is reported to the police, we can have evidence. Other side attractions at the FIBA sensitization program include: the Drama Presentation by the students of the school and violent against person provision act
